
Tina Tingyu worked on the kubernetes/kubernetes and kubernetes/website repositories, focusing on backend development and documentation for certificate management features. She upgraded the PodCertificateRequests API, introducing user annotations and enhanced resource definitions using Go and JSON schema design, and implemented end-to-end tests and metrics to improve reliability. Tina also addressed logging stability by refining flag handling and updated container images to streamline deployments. Her work included authoring technical documentation aligned with KEP-4317, clarifying runtime configuration for users. Additionally, she developed an atomic transport holder for seamless CA rotation, enhancing client resilience and reducing operational risk during certificate lifecycle events.
March 2026 performance summary for kubernetes/kubernetes focused on reliability around certificate rotation. Delivered a feature to enable seamless CA rotation handling by introducing an atomic transport holder that manages CA data and updates the transport when CA files change. This enables clients to gracefully handle CA rotations without dropping connections or requiring restarts, improving uptime during certificate lifecycle events. No major bugs fixed in this period for the repo. Overall impact includes increased client resilience, reduced operational risk during CA rotations, and smoother certificate lifecycle automation. Technologies demonstrated include Go-based transport-layer design, atomic data handling, and client-go integration, highlighting practical value to production clusters.

October 2025 — Delivered two core outcomes for kubernetes/kubernetes: (1) logging stability improvements by removing the --logtostderr flag in mtlsclient/mtlsserver to prevent unknown flag errors; (2) release upgrade by bumping agnhost image to 2.59 to incorporate the latest changes. These changes reduce operational risk, improve logging reliability, and align with current release practices. Technical skills demonstrated include Go code changes, flag handling, logging configuration, container image management, and release coordination. Business value: fewer runtime errors, smoother deployments, and faster access to the latest features and fixes.

September 2025 monthly summary for kubernetes/kubernetes: Delivered a robust upgrade of the PodCertificateRequests API from v1alpha1 to v1beta1, adding user annotations and enhanced resource definitions. This work was complemented by end-to-end tests, metrics collection, and event handling to improve observability and reliability of pod certificate management. The CRD was promoted to v1beta1, aligning with stability expectations and enabling better long-term maintenance. No major defects were reported this month; the focus was on delivering a scalable upgrade path and improved operational visibility.
